New route from Prague to the Chinese island of Hainan (visa free)

Hainan statue

Kazakh airline SCAT has launched sales on a surprise new route from Prague to Sanya, China, the largest resort city on Hainan Island.

The island is often referred to as "China's Hawaii" due to its beaches and beautiful scenery.

If you arrive on Hainan Island by direct international flight, no Chinese visa is required for a tourist stay of up to 30 days.

Return tickets for all dates are currently available for 582 eur.

The route will operate once a week on Sundays with a Boeing 737 MAX 9 with a stopover for refueling in Bishkek, Kyrgyzstan.

  • Prague - Sanya
    • departure at 16:50, arrival in China at 12:30 the following day
  • Sanya - Prague
    • Departure at 8:05, arrival in Prague at 15:20

SCAT will use the so-called 7th freedom on this route, i.e. the right to fly between two foreign countries without crossing the territory of one's own country, which is very unusual for long-haul routes.
